At their core, heatpump operate on the concept of thermodynamics, using a refrigerant to soak up and launch warmth. During the winter, heatpump extract warm from the outside air or ground and transfer it inside your home, effectively heating your home also in winter conditions. Conversely, in the summertime, heat pumps turn around the procedure, removing warmth from within your home and removing it outdoors, giving a cooling impact. This twin functionality makes heatpump a highly effective choice that can change conventional heating and cooling systems.

There are mostly 3 types of heat pumps: air-source, ground-source (or geothermal), and water-source. Air-source heat pumps are one of the most typical and are usually easier and cheaper to install. [url]check it out![/url] Ground-source heat pumps utilize the planet’s stable temperature level to give heating & cooling, needing more comprehensive installment but using greater efficiency in some environments. Water-source heatpump function similarly yet rely upon bodies of water, such as lakes or fish ponds, to trade warmth. One of the standout advantages of heat pumps is their power effectiveness. Unlike typical heating unit that burn fuel, heat pumps can create approximately three times extra power than they take in, bring about lower power bills and reduced carbon emissions. Furthermore, numerous heat pumps are qualified for government rewards and discounts, making them a a lot more appealing selection for homeowners looking to upgrade their heating and cooling systems.
